If you're interested, you could ideally write a test suite for it under
existing tools/testing/selftests/bpf/. If you enable JIT in the mode
net.core.bpf_jit_enable=2, then you'll get the debug output dump in klog
and under tools/net/ you have bpf_jit_disasm tool that you could use to
examine it. This could likely be automated in a tool for various test
inputs, but probably needs to have some arch specific code to make sense
out of it. There's also lib/test_bpf.c, if it's not too much complexity,
something could also be placed there for checking the image directly.

>> I've added Elena and Daniel to CC, who both worked on the blinding.
>> The goal would be to add some kind of test that inserted constants in
>> eBPF instructions and then verified they were gone in the resulting
>> eBPF JIT kernel code. Until now, it's only been done manually, and
>> it'd be nice to have a test that could show if there were regressions
>> or if an architecture didn't support the blinding in its JIT.
